Compare all specifications:
1984 Ferrari 208 | 1989 Maserati 228 | |
Make | Ferrari | Maserati |
Model | 208 | 228 |
Year Released | 1984 | 1989 |
Engine Position | Middle | Front |
Engine Size | 1990 cc | 2790 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| V |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 3 valves |
Horse Power | 217 HP | 252 HP |
Engine RPM | 7000 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Torque | 240 Nm | 366 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4800 RPM | 2900 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Vehicle Weight | 1285 kg | 1265 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4240 mm | 4470 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1730 mm | 1870 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1130 mm | 1340 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2350 mm | 2610 mm |
